I had that issue--all the dash lights on, first my Indy thought it was the ABS unit, then the sender, then found the ring (with gear sprockets--assume that's what you mean) separated, and said it was the first he had seen like that. He could have charged me for much more, as some do, but finally settled only on that. He said the Chinese CV joints are crap, and he obtained a SAAB part (18 moths ago, expensive). It's a crucial part, and if the Chines unit is crap, not good. A used one, which can be easily inspected to see its condition, might be fine, but mail order on that might get you more crap, unless you have a reliable supplier --Genuine SAAB might be a reliable source-people have complained some here about Eeuroparts Chinese parts.
